The town of Natick is seeking a Program Manager for Camps and Youth Programs to join the Recreation and Parks Division at the Cole Center. This role is responsible for planning, organizing, and supervising a wide range of camps, youth activities, and community programs that meet the needs and interests of residents.
Key Responsibilities
Plan, coordinate, and oversee summer camps in compliance with state and local regulations.
Develop, promote, and evaluate recreation programs in collaboration with department staff.
Recruit, train, and supervise seasonal staff, contractors, and volunteers.
Manage program budgets, grants, sponsorships, and related resources.
Organize and maintain program supplies and equipment.
Partner with committees, community organizations, and town departments to deliver special events and programs.
Foster a positive, professional team environment and ensure excellent customer service.
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in social services, human services, recreation, or a related field.
At least three years of relevant experience, including two years in a supervisory role with youth or camp programs.
Current (or ability to obtain within six months) First Aid/CPR/AED certification.
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ation.
Desired Skills and Knowledge
Strong background in recreation, sports, or youth programming.
Experience with program planning, budgeting, and evaluation.
Knowledge of marketing, public relations, and community outreach.
Proficiency with recreation software or database systems.
Excellent communication, leadership, and organizational skills.

The town of Natick offers a competitive salary and a generous benefits package. This position is classified as Grade 3 on the town’s pay plan, with a hiring range of $65,000-$72,000 commensurate with education and experience.
